
The Rashad Richey Morning Show sits down with City of Stonecrest (DeKalb County, GA) Mayor Jason Lary and Councilwoman Jazzmin Cobble to discuss recent controversy in the city stemming from a lawsuit and filed temporary restraining order.
The mayor initially filed suit against the councilwoman for missing 2 regularly scheduled council meetings. According to Mayor Lary, Councilwoman Cobble was in violation of the city charter. The city later filed a notice of dismissal without prejudice on Tuesday, February 18th in the civil action case against Councilwoman Jazzmin Cobble. The city sought a declaratory judgment to interpret the provision of the city’s charter, which states a councilmember forfeits their seat by failing to attend one-third of the meetings in three months. Cobble supporters argue that the language in the charter is ambiguous at best and does not allow for removal of a duly elected public official.
Mayor Jason Lary says, "stay in your lane, you legislate, I administrate"
Councilwoman Jazzmin Cobble says, "I pray we can put our personal issues aside, and do whats best for the city"
